Owen Guske (born February 18, 2002) is an American soccer player who plays as a defender for Orlando City B as a member of the Orlando City academy.[1]

Career

Orlando City

Guske joined the Orlando City academy in 2019, appearing in 15 Development Academy matches in his opening season with the club. In August 2020, Guske made his professional debut with Orlando's USL League One affiliate Orlando City B, starting against New England Revolution II.[2]

International

In February 2016, Guske was called into a nine-day training camp with the United States U17 team.[3]
